February 15, 200521 yr Author Commercial Member The visibility is computed off the difference between your temperature and dewpoints that you select for the Global Weather Scape. The closer together the more likely your visibility will go below 10nm.Weather Scapes will take longer to load, because basically, Weather Maker Pro has to completely simulate the entire atmosphere for a region based upon the parameters you select, plus load all the features listed on a map. Basically it should only take less than 5 minutes to load. It is much more complex then just loading metar and taf data.In regards to the deleting a placed weather feature. There are somethings you can enhance and some you can't. Placing a weather feature on a map is using a complex formula to detect the actual Latitude and Longtitude on top of calling GDI functions in Windows to draw that feature. To undo this individual feature becomes even more complex. For now it will have to remain. If you have any additional questions you can contact me at: [email protected].
